Preguntas frecuentes sobre Montgomery County
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Montgomery County?
Actualmente hay 51 Apartamentos Estudios en Montgomery County con alquileres que van desde $469 hasta $1,710, con un precio medio de $1,117.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Montgomery County?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Montgomery County varian entre $335 y $5,460 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,417
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Montgomery County?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Montgomery County van desde $585 hasta $8,999.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,871
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Montgomery County?
En estos momentos hay 197 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Montgomery County en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,200 y $17,028 - con una media de $2,326 para el lugar.
